3:40p – 4:50p (2) Althea Rene

Althea Rene has worked more than 10 years as a Wayne County Deputy Sheriff (Detroit, Michigan).  Today, Ms. René is a full-time performing artist and is regarded among musicians and enthusiasts as one of the nations most exciting solo improvisational flautists.  Although ‘In The Moment’ emphasizes Ms. Rene’s exceptional skill, soul, and artistic versatility; her live concerts better showcase her huge talent.

7:00p – 8:10p (4) Jessy J

"Few musicians, no matter the musical genre, have made as powerful of an immediate impact as this talented multi-instrumentalist and composer."  With her sizzling mix of hot beats, Latin and samba rhythms, instantly captivating melodies, and model looks, this Mexican American saxophonist/singer proved quite the sensation with her debut CD Tequila Moon, earning her such accolades as Radio and Records “Debut Artist of The Year”
